How they compare
Bangladesh currently reports 0.5109 against 0.4895 in Iran, a difference of 0.0214.
The two have swapped places 5 times across 13 shared years of data; in 1997 it was Iran ahead.
Bangladesh ranks 169th and Iran ranks 172nd of 182 countries.
Across the 3 decades both report, Bangladesh averaged higher in 1 and Iran in 2.
Head to head by decade
| Decade | Bangladesh | Iran | Difference | Ahead |
|---|---|---|---|---|
| 1990s | 0.1602 | 0.3714 | 0.2112 | Iran |
| 2000s | 0.3474 | 0.6094 | 0.2619 | Iran |
| 2010s | 0.5306 | 0.4516 | 0.079 | Bangladesh |
Averages of every year both report within each decade.

About this data
This dataset provides information on the bilateral trade flows of low-carbon technology products, as well as country and world aggregates . Low carbon technology products produce less pollution than their traditional energy counterparts, and will play a vital role in the transition to a low carbon economy. Low carbon technologies include mechanics like wind turbines, solar panels, biomass systems and carbon capture equipment.
